1. Introduction

T h e F 9 4 0 W G OT s e r i e s ( h e r e a f t e r c a l l e d “ G OT ” ) i s t o b e
mounted on the face of a control panel or operations panel, and
c o n n e c t e d t o t h e p r o g r a m m i n g p o r t ( C P U p o r t ) o r t h e
communication por t (communication port) of a PLC.
Va r i o u s d ev i c e s c a n b e m o n i t o r e d a n d P L C d a t a c h a n g e d
through the GOT screens. Several display screens are built-in to
the GOT, and additional personalized screens can be created by
the user.

1) The GOT can connect to MELSEC FX, A, QnA and Q PLCs

as well as a host of third par ty manufactured units. Fur ther
in for ma ti o n c an b e fou n d in G OT-F 9 00 S e r i es H a r d wa r e
Manual.

2) PLC user programs can be downloaded, uploaded and monitored using programming software GX-

Developer or FX-PCS/WIN-E on a personal computer via the GOT. Further information can be found
in GOT-F900 Series Operation Manual.

Caution

During abnormal communication (including cable breakages) ages when monitor within the
GOT, communication between the GOT and programmable controller CPU is interrupted. It is
impossible to operate switches or devices in the PLC through the GOT.
Communication and normal operation resumes when the GOT system is correctly configured.
DO NOT configure emergency stop or safety features to operate through the GOT, and be
sure that there is no adverse consequences in the event of a GOT - PLC communications
malfunction.

Note;

Do not lay signal cables near high voltage power cables or allow them to share the same
trunking duct, otherwise, effects of noise or surge induction are likely to take please. Keep
a safe distance of more than 100 mm from these wires.

Operate touch switches on the display screen by hand.
DO NOT use excessive force, or attempt operate them with hard or pointed objects.
The tip of a screw driver, pen or similar object for example may break the screen.

2. Specifications

2.1 General Specifications

Port

Description

COM0

RS-422 port for connecting PLC (including1:N connection) or communication
(computer link) unit <9-pin D-sub>

COM1

RS-232C port for connecting PLC (including1:N connection), printer or bar-code
reader <9-pin D-sub>

COM2

RS-232C port for connecting personal computer, printer or bar-code reader
<9-pin D-sub>
